How this calculator works

We use the NatHERS national average energy intensity per star rating — published by CSIRO and the NatHERS Administrator — combined with current state electricity rates from the AER Default Market Offer 2025-26 and the Victorian Default Offer 2025-26.

Energy use (MJ/m²/yr) is converted to kWh and multiplied by your state's average retail tariff. The 10-year projection assumes a 3% annual price increase, which is broadly in line with the AEMC's residential price trend forecast.

Estimates exclude appliance and hot water energy use. For a verified figure specific to your home, request a NatHERS Existing Homes assessment.

Frequently asked questions

How much can I save by improving my home's energy rating?

Most Australian homes built before 2010 sit between 1.5 and 3 stars. Upgrading to 6 stars typically cuts heating and cooling energy use by 60–75%, which translates to $800 – $2,500 in annual energy savings depending on your state, dwelling size and climate.

What's the most cost-effective upgrade to improve a NatHERS rating?

Draught-proofing and ceiling insulation give the best return. Draught-sealing typically costs $300–$1,500 with payback in 1–2 years. Ceiling insulation upgrades to R6.0 cost $1,500–$4,500 and pay back in 3–6 years while adding up to 1.5 stars.

Are these savings figures accurate for my home?

These are estimates using average NatHERS energy consumption figures and current state electricity prices (Jan 2026 AER/VDO data). Actual savings depend on your home's orientation, occupancy patterns, appliances and behaviour. For an accurate figure, get a NatHERS Existing Homes assessment.

Do solar panels improve my NatHERS rating?

No — NatHERS rates the building fabric (insulation, glazing, sealing, thermal mass), not appliances or generation. Solar PV doesn't change your star rating but dramatically reduces running costs. The best results come from combining fabric upgrades with solar and electrification.

Are there government rebates for energy efficiency upgrades?

Yes. Federal STCs cover heat pumps and solar; from July 2025 the Cheaper Home Batteries Program cuts ~30% off batteries. State schemes include VEU (VIC), ESS (NSW), REES (SA) and HEER (QLD). See our rebates page for current eligibility.
